The short version
With 71 people, Greenville is a city in Iowa. Owners hold 100% of the housing stock. Four-year degrees are less common here than nationally, at 6% of adults. The median age is 30.5, younger than the US median of 38.8. 0% of people here were born outside the United States. People stay put here: 98% were in the same home a year ago.

Frequently asked
How many people live in Greenville, Iowa? Greenville, Iowa has about 71 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Greenville, Iowa? The typical household in Greenville, Iowa earns about $47,500 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
How educated are people in Greenville, Iowa? About 5.7% of adults age 25 and over in Greenville, Iowa h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Greenville, Iowa? About 17.7% of people in Greenville, Iowa live below the federal poverty line.
